Between a Rock and a Hard Place (I to V) and Beneath Enemy Rocks are the achievements linked to winning Seal Rock up to 300 times. We also have In a Blaze of Glory (Fields of Glory), One Steppe at a Time (Onsal Hakair), and Workor and Peace (Workor Chirteh), with similar progression and requirements.
However, there is one crucial difference between Seal Rock and the equivalent for the other three maps: Seal Rock allow you to get these wins combined between any Grand Company you may be afiliated with.
So, right now, if you are part of the Maelstrom, get 290 wins on Fields of Glory, and swap Grand Company to be on Immortal Flames, you basically stalled all your In Blaze of Glory progress until you decide to go back to Maelstrom, or you grind another 300 wins while under Immortal Flames banner.
Doing so, would NOT stall your Between a Rock and a Hard Place progress, because if you get 10 more wins while under the Immortal Flames banner, you complete your 300 wins and finish it.
It gets even worse when you realize your achievement progress screen will only show you the highest win count across all Grand Companies, so you have no idea if you are close enough to keep running on your current GC or which company you was when you got your highest win count.
All that could be solved simply by making the map-specific achievements combine wins across Grand Companies.
